Tinggalkan komentar

Flow Control Switch C#, Java, C++

Flow Control Switch C#

Alhamdulilah saya senang bisa menyajikan ini… sebenernya saya gak pandai berkata kata jadi langsung aja dech…..

ni program  saya buat demi pengetahuan dan tuntutan
hehehehehehehehee…. kalau tuntutannya jangan di sebuti lah gk penting langsung ke programnya aja dech..

di bawah ini program C# seperti contohnya mari kita lihat langsung


using System;

namespace FlowControl_Switch_C_
{
 class cl_laluLintas
 {

 private int warna; //deklarasi variabel

 public cl_laluLintas(int isi){ //contruktor dengan parameter
 //judul info lampu lalu lintas:
 warna =Convert.ToInt32(isi);
 Console.WriteLine("1.warna merah");
 Console.WriteLine("2.warna kuning");
 Console.WriteLine("3.warna hijau");
 Console.WriteLine("______________");
 }
 public void Pilih(){
 Console.Write("silahkan pilih [1|2|3] ? "); //input user
 warna = Convert.ToInt32(Console.ReadLine());
 }
 public void MasukSwitch(){
 //pengunaan Switch
 switch (warna) {
 case 1:
 Console.Write("yang anda harus lakukan adlah : ");
 Console.WriteLine("berhenti");
 break;
 case 2:
 Console.Write("yang anda harus lakukan adlah : ");
 Console.WriteLine("hati-hati");
 break;
 case 3:
 Console.Write("yang anda harus lakukan adlah : ");
 Console.WriteLine("berjalan");
 break;
 default:
 Console.WriteLine("nomor yg anda tulis tdak ada...");
 Console.WriteLine("contoh : silahkan pilih [1|2|3] ? 2");
 break;
 }
 }
 }
 class Program
 {
 public static void Main(string[] args)
 {
 cl_laluLintas masuk = new cl_laluLintas(0);

 masuk.Pilih(); //mengEksekusi public void Pilih()
 masuk.MasukSwitch(); //mengEksekusi public void MasukSwitch()

 Console.ReadKey(true);
 }
 }
}

Dan contoh kompelingnya adalah seperti ini sobat

Flow Control Switch Java

dan ini program java hampir mirip dengan  C# tapi berbeda perintahnya


package switch_byJava;
import java.util.*;

class cl_laluLintas{

 private int warna; //deklarasi variabel
 private Scanner in = new Scanner(System.in);
 public cl_laluLintas(int isi){ //contruktor dengan parameter
 //judul info lampu lalu lintas:
 warna =(int)(isi);
 System.out.println("1.warna merah");
 System.out.println("2.warna kuning");
 System.out.println("3.warna hijau");
 System.out.println("______________");
 }
 public void Pilih(){
 System.out.print("silahkan pilih [1|2|3] ? "); //input user
 warna = in.nextInt();
 }
 public void MasukSwitch(){

 //pengunaan Switch
 switch (warna) {
 case 1:
 System.out.print("yang anda harus lakukan adlah : ");
 System.out.println("berhenti");
 break;
 case 2:
 System.out.print("yang anda harus lakukan adlah : ");
 System.out.println("hati-hati");
 break;
 case 3:
 System.out.print("yang anda harus lakukan adlah : ");
 System.out.println("berjalan");
 break;
 default:
 System.out.println("nomor yg anda tulis tdak ada...");
 System.out.println("contoh : silahkan pilih [1|2|3] ? 2");
 break;
 }

}
}

public class Main {

public static void main(String[] args) {
 // TODO Auto-generated method stub

System.out.println("pengunaan switch");
 cl_laluLintas masuk = new cl_laluLintas(0);

 masuk.Pilih(); //mengEksekusi public void Pilih()
 masuk.MasukSwitch(); //mengEksekusi public void MasukSwitch()

 }

}

ini kompelingnya beda bentuk tetap sama maksutnya

Flow Control Switch C++

Dan yang ini C++ pemrograman juga  tp agak beda dan maksutnya sama saja sama yang di atas
hehehehehehehehehe…..


#include <cstdlib>
#include <iostream>

using namespace std;

class cl_laluLintas{

 private : int warna; //deklarasi variabel
 public :

 cl_laluLintas(int isi){ //contruktor dengan parameter
 //judul info lampu lalu lintas:
 warna =(int)(isi);
 cout << "1.warna merah" << endl;
 cout << "2.warna kuning" << endl;
 cout << "3.warna hijau" << endl;
 cout << "______________" << endl;
 }
 void Pilih(){
 cout << "silahkan pilih [1|2|3] ? "; //input user
 cin >> warna ;
 }
 void MasukSwitch(){

 //pengunaan Switch
 switch (warna) {
 case 1:
 cout << "yang anda harus lakukan adlah : ";
 cout << "berhenti" << endl;
 break;
 case 2:
 cout << "yang anda harus lakukan adlah : ";
 cout << "hati-hati" << endl;
 break;
 case 3:
 cout << "yang anda harus lakukan adlah : ";
 cout << "berjalan" << endl;
 break;
 default:
 cout << "nomor yg anda tulis tdak ada..." << endl;
 cout << "contoh : silahkan pilih [1|2|3] ? 2" << endl;
 break;
 }

}
};

int main()
{
 cl_laluLintas masuk = 0;
 masuk.Pilih(); //mengEksekusi public void Pilih()
 masuk.MasukSwitch(); //mengEksekusi public void MasukSwitch()

 system("PAUSE");
 return EXIT_SUCCESS;
}

hasil kompelingnya

Tinggalkan komentar